Handover note — Crumbwheel order cutoffs.

Welcome aboard. The bakery cutoff rule in Crumbwheel closes same-day orders at 14:00 local to each storefront, not UTC — this has bitten us twice. Holiday overrides live in the calendar service and take precedence silently, so always check there first when a cutoff looks wrong. To unlock the calendar service's admin console after a restart, enter the recovery passphrase below.

vault phrase of bagap-bahaf = silion-pelox-sorox-casdor-quenwyn-fraax-eliox-praael-kelion-quenvan-kasox-rusael-norius-belvan

## Idempotency Keys for Payment Retries (Lumopay)

Every retry of a charge request must reuse the original idempotency key; generating a new key on retry can produce duplicate charges. Keys are scoped per merchant and expire after 48 hours. Reviewers should verify keys are derived server-side, never from client input. The full key-generation specification and threat model are maintained on the internal page.

dashboard of kaguf-tawip = https://vault.merlaqsys.test/issue

Meeting notes — dispatch coordination, item 4

Discussed the locked case of Verro-9 test devices currently held in the secure cage. Agreed the case remains sealed until collection; under no circumstances is it to be opened for inventory checks, as the seal numbers are already recorded. The case travels to the Aldenreach test site by bonded courier on Tuesday. Dispatch desk to verify the courier's collection docket against the manifest before release. Once verified, the confidential hand-over instruction to be given verbally is this:

handover note for yagef-bagep: the drudor pelius courier leaves the kasdor zorvan norir ledger at gate 8016 under passcode 755406

**Mgmt Meeting Minutes — Retiring the Brightline Range**

Quick recap for sales leads at Fenholt Supplies: we agreed to retire the Brightline fixture range by year-end. Remaining stock moves to clearance pricing next month, and accounts on standing orders get migrated to the Lumetta range. Trade-in incentives were approved in principle. The confidential note on next steps sits just below.

board note of bajof-bajeg: The pricing group signed off on a budget of $13.4 million for Project Sildor. The renewal with Lamixek Holdings closes at $48.9 million a year, 49 percent above the last contract.